Speaker Series: Electrification and the 2030 Commitment by Paul Poirier

The Central Coast Green Building Council (CCGBC) & the Ventura College Architecture Department are teaming up to present virtual, monthly, hour-long presentations by professionals within the realm of green building. Join us during this presentation from 6:00pm-7:00pm on April 28th, where CCGBC board member Paul Poirier of Paul Poirier + Associates Architects, will be discussing electrification & the 2030 Commitment. Presentation to provide insights into the AIA 2030 Commitment and Architectural Practice as well as how to sign up for the 2030 Commitment as a transformative tool by the architect in designing architectural buildings. The workshop provides a hands-on review of the Firms Sustainability Action Plan (SAP) and The AIA COTE’s Framework for Design Excellence. Best Practices used to document data used for reporting online in California, i.e., the Design Data Exchange (DDx), use of Zero Tool, et al, and other lessons learned during the process to achieve net-zero carbon and elevated code compliance goals.

Presentation to provide an overview of electrification efforts in California and local efforts on the central coast. What does a zero net carbon building look like? A walkthrough of the recently completed USFS offices in Solvang, California a zero net carbon project. All members of the building industry have an important role to play in mitigating climate change. This session’s content will apply to all types of work: small to large, residential and commercial, interiors and whole building, new construction, and renovation.
